Analysis
The most recent figure for cereals, primary — gross production value in Bosnia and Herzegovina is 436,831 1000 SLC,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of up 8.0% on the previous year and up 35.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, cereals, primary — gross production value in Bosnia and Herzegovina peaked at 891,565 1000 SLC in 2022 and was at its lowest, 94,319 1000 SLC, in 1996.
Bosnia and Herzegovina ranks 117th of 152 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 29 years of available data.
Cereals, primary — Gross Production Value in Bosnia and Herzegovina, year by year
| Year | 1000 SLC |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1996 | 94,319 1000 SLC | — |
| 1997 | 195,697 1000 SLC | +107.5% |
| 1998 | 250,471 1000 SLC | +28.0% |
| 1999 | 313,398 1000 SLC | +25.1% |
| 2000 | 253,096 1000 SLC | -19.2% |
| 2001 | 317,300 1000 SLC | +25.4% |
| 2002 | 301,403 1000 SLC | -5.0% |
| 2003 | 216,436 1000 SLC | -28.2% |
| 2004 | 415,158 1000 SLC | +91.8% |
| 2005 | 348,713 1000 SLC | -16.0% |
| 2006 | 352,829 1000 SLC | +1.2% |
| 2007 | 382,874 1000 SLC | +8.5% |
| 2008 | 591,935 1000 SLC | +54.6% |
| 2009 | 362,346 1000 SLC | -38.8% |
| 2010 | 336,459 1000 SLC | -7.1% |
| 2011 | 436,186 1000 SLC | +29.6% |
| 2012 | 408,964 1000 SLC | -6.2% |
| 2013 | 457,341 1000 SLC | +11.8% |
| 2014 | 322,634 1000 SLC | -29.5% |
| 2015 | 358,818 1000 SLC | +11.2% |
| 2016 | 475,101 1000 SLC | +32.4% |
| 2017 | 366,539 1000 SLC | -22.9% |
| 2018 | 480,858 1000 SLC | +31.2% |
| 2019 | 476,604 1000 SLC | -0.9% |
| 2020 | 582,587 1000 SLC | +22.2% |
| 2021 | 588,620 1000 SLC | +1.0% |
| 2022 | 891,565 1000 SLC | +51.5% |
| 2023 | 404,592 1000 SLC | -54.6% |
| 2024 | 436,831 1000 SLC | +8.0% |

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
